Sample thanks to Grumbo: Poured a deep brown with red edges, head was thin tan creamy frothy. Aroma is dark fruit, raisin, light booze, sweet almost lactose like, malty. Taste is sugary, raisin, light rum, roasty malts.

23/1/2021. Fresh crowler shared at the first Ipswich Lockdown 3.0 virtual bottle share. From Tom's Tap & Brewhouse, Crewe. Pours very dark brown with a purple tint and a small off-white to beige head. Aroma doesn't really deliver the rum'n'raisin promised. Moderate sweetness, light roasted bitterness. Light bodied, soft carbonation. As a milk stout it's fine but I like rum'n'raisin but didn't really get much from this one.
